I am giving away two Tooth Tunes Toothbrushes and a tube of Sensodyne Pronamel Tootpaste.
My kids love Tooth Tunes. The song on each Tooth Tune toothbrush plays for two minutes, so you know that your child is brushing their teeth for the recommended amount of time. The toothbrush sends sounds vibrations streaming from the bristles through your child’s teeth. You can actually hear the music inside your head! Just press the button, wait for the beep and brush away! You can increase the volume, by simply increase your brushing pressure!
Included in this giveaway is a pink Hannah Montana Tooth Tunes toothbrush which plays Rock Star and a red Junior Transformers Tooth Tunes toothbrush which plays the them to the animated Transformers series.

Also included in this giveaway is a tube of Sensodyne ProNamel Toothpaste. I recently found out about this toothpaste and I am impressed. No matter how hard I try sometimes, my kids still seem to get cavities. If you are like me, you probably have a hard time getting your children to brush their teeth and brush them well.
It seems that diets today are not nearly as healthy as they used to be and this can contribute to acid erosion. Acid erosion is a growing problem among adults and children. Most parents do not think that their child is at risk for acid erosion that can cause enamel loss.
[photopress:SEN84020Tube.jpg,full,pp_image]
Sensodyne, a leader in sensitive teeth products, has developed a product called Sensodyne ProNamel for Children. It is a pediatric toothpaste designed to help re-harden tooth enamel.
